The Table following is that of the Helalee or practical year, the Hissabce or Astronomical year invariably precedes it by one day, that is to say the commencement of the æra of the flight, occurred according to the Hissabee or Astronomical computation on Thursday, the 15th of July,* and by the Helalee or practical account on Friday, the 16th of July, A. D. 622.

The following is a translated extract from Moolla Ali Kooschee's commentary on the Zeej Ooloog Beg, by a learned native of Bombay: "to find out the day of the weck on which the Hijræ Hissabee year commences, divide the given year by 210, because every 210th year closes on Wednesday, and the next new year commences on Thursday again; and out of the remainder deduct one, for the incomplete commencing year, and the rest divide by thirty: the quotient thereof to be multiplied by five, and the sum total taken down; if there be any remaining years, separate the leap and ordinary years, and multiply the former by five, and the latter by four, and the sum total of both, add to the former sum, and to this again add five mare, divide the amount by seven, and the remainder computed from Sunday, will give the day of the week on which the given year commenced.”—Note, that if you do not add the last five; but only one, being the first day of the Commencing year, and divide it by seven, then compute the remainder from Thursday, and you will likewise find the same day of the week required for the commencement of the given year.

According to the oriental mode of calculation the epochs are taken from Sunday, the first day of the Hijræ Hissabee commenced however on Thursday the fifth day, wherefore the five is added as above shewn.

The following are the days of the European calendar corresponding with the initial days of the Moohummudan years for the first 1300 Moohummudan lunar years: with the correction of the Gregorian calendar introduced, A. D. 1582.

The Moohummudan years marked with an E have 355 days-The European years marked with a star are leap years.

If the series of intercalations vary from that above given or fall on the years following, 24, 5th, 7th, 10th, 13th, 16th, 18th, 21st, 24th, 26th and 20th of the cycle of thirty years, the only dif ference will be that the 8th, 19th and 27th years will be one day more in advance, or the initial days of the first lunar cycle occur on the 1st May, 2d January, and 7th October, which differences are accordingly marked throughout with Italics. Further if the series be as above, but the intercalation fall on the 15th year, instead of the 16th, then the 16th will be one day in advance, or begin on the 3d February, which case is marked throughout the Tables with a (+).
